当前位置:主页 > 社科论文 > 逻辑论文 >

Process Control中可配置的业务搜索逻辑的重构与实现

发布时间:2023-03-02 18:11
  SAP GRC (Governance, Risk and Control)解决方案是包含Process Control,Risk Management,Access Control等一整套应用方案的集合。该解决方案专门针对企业内部审计和内部控制的业务需求。但随着2002年美国萨班斯法案的颁布与实施,上市企业对GRC解决方案内部各种应用方案的集成提出了更高的要求。此时对解决方案内部的系统集成成为所有工作的重点。 Process Control中的验证与报表模块作为Process Control中的核心模块之一,同样需要改变来适应不断变化的业务需求,不仅要处理Process Control应用方案内部的数据,同时还要处理其他应用方案的数据。而原有系统经过长时间的维护与更新,早已无法满足扩展性,维护性和重用性等多方面的需求。本文详细论述了对原有系统进行分析,设计以及重构和实现的全过程,并对原有的业务搜索逻辑进行改进,以进一步满足系统可配置性的需求。本文主要论述了以下几点: 1.介绍了本次课题的业务背景。SAP GRC解决方案完全针对萨班斯法案中关于企业内部控制与内部审计的要求,为客户提供了...

【文章页数】:80 页

【学位级别】:硕士

【文章目录】:
摘要
ABSTRACT
1 绪论
    1.1 课题研究背景和意义
    1.2 作者承担的工作
    1.3 本文的篇章结构
2 业务知识背景概述
    2.1 萨班斯法案(SOX 法案)的由来
    2.2 SAP GRC 解决方案
    2.3 Process Control 应用方案
    2.4 Process Control 的验证与报表模块
3 技术知识背景概述
    3.1 基于面向过程的设计
    3.2 基于面向对象的设计
    3.3 统一建模语言 UML
    3.4 SAP NetWeaver 平台
    3.5 ABAP 语言
    3.6 Web Dynpro 技术
    3.7 Crystal Report
4 对现有的基于面向过程设计的业务搜索逻辑的分析
    4.1 业务搜索逻辑的定义及结构
        4.1.1 界面输出模块(UI)
        4.1.2 后台搜索逻辑模块(Searching Logic)
    4.2 对现有的业务搜索逻辑的分析
        4.2.1 界面输出模块的缺陷与所面临的问题
        4.2.2 后台搜索逻辑模块的缺陷与所面临的问题
    4.3 本章小结
5 基于面向对象设计的可配置的业务搜索逻辑的重构与实现
    5.1 统一命名规范
    5.2 基于UML 的系统分析
        5.2.1 系统用例分析
        5.2.2 系统活动图
    5.3 基于UML 的面向对象的系统设计与重构
        5.3.1 面向对象设计的基本原则
        5.3.2 基于面向对象的业务数据抽象化
        5.3.3 将基于 Function Group 的 API 转化为基于类的的 API
        5.3.4 重构业务搜索与遍历逻辑
        5.3.5 使用 Walking strategy 实现业务搜索逻辑的可配置
    5.4 本章小结
6 新的可配置的业务搜索逻辑的使用效果
    6.1 来自开发人员的反馈
        6.1.1 显著提高了工作效率
        6.1.2 大量减轻维护工作时的负担
        6.1.3 有着良好的重用性
    6.2 来自客户方的反馈
        6.2.1 具有良好的扩展性
        6.2.2 友好并且易用的用户体验
7 总结与展望
    7.1 总结
    7.2 展望和下一步工作
参考文献
致谢
攻读学位期间发表的学术论文目录



本文编号:3752385

资料下载
论文发表

本文链接:https://www.wllwen.com/shekelunwen/ljx/3752385.html


Copyright(c)文论论文网All Rights Reserved | 网站地图

版权申明:资料由用户e1fe0***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com